Spanish edition of " Sortalansag" a novel by the Hungarian novelist Imre KertÈsz written between 1969 and 1973 and first published in 1975. The novel is a semi-autobiographical story about a 14-year-old Hungarian Jew's experiences in the Auschwitz and Buchenwald concentration camps. KertÈsz won the Nobel Prize for Literature in 2002, "for writing that upholds the fragile experience of the individual against the barbaric arbitrariness of history". Traduccion del Hungaro: Judith Xantus Fzarvas. A movie version, with screenplay by Imre KertÈsz, was released in 2005, made in Hungary by director Lajos Koltai, with Marcell Nagy in the starring role.
